ICYMI: Sen. Cruz on Fox Discussing Bergdahl Release and Free Speech

WASHINGTON, D.C. -- U.S. Sen. Ted Cruz, R-Texas, last night spoke with Megyn Kelly regarding the Obama Administration's deal to release Sgt. Bowe Bergdahl and the Democrats' proposed amendment to the Constitution that would repeal individual free speech protections enshrined in the First Amendment. See highlights below.

On Sgt. Bergdahl's release:

"This entire deal is extremely troubling. The President decided to make a deal with terrorists... and we released five senior Taliban terrorists.... How many soldiers lost their lives to capture these five Taliban terrorists? And how many soldiers may lose their lives in the future if and when these Taliban return to making war against Americans?"

On the First Amendment:

"[The Democrats] filed an amendment to the Constitution that would repeal the free speech protections of the First Amendment.... This should trouble everyone - elected Democrats are trying to give Congress the power to muzzle citizens, to muzzle both Planned Parenthood and the National Right to Life, to muzzle the NRA and the Brady Center for Handgun Control, to muzzle labor unions, to muzzle individual citizens, to ban books and movies, and that is contrary to the most fundamental protections our democracy is built on."
